These effluvia are conveyed to a distance by currents, and produce their
peculiar effects, more or less, upon almost all they encounter. The
malaria at Rome is carried by the wind into the city, by the channels
most open to its entrance; and those parts, it is said by medical men
who reside there, that are most exposed to the wind blowing off the
adjacent marshy grounds, are most unhealthy. It is for that reason that
the suburbs are more unwholesome than the interior of that city, where
the wind does not find ready access, on account of the obstacles offered
to its course by the high buildings. The high houses and streets thus
act as a barrier against the entrance of the pestilence, and it is even
said that the narrowest streets there, are the most healthy, as they
shut out the pestilential vapour.
An obstacle of the same kind is offered by hills which interrupt the
course of winds carrying with them vapours from marshy grounds. In the
West Indies, where the yellow fever commits such frightful ravages, many
instances are known where a town or district retains its health, from
the shelter which a hill affords against the visitation of a wind that
has loaded itself with deadly miasms, while sweeping over a marsh or
swamp. It is the practice of those residing in those countries, not only
to remove from the swamps, but also from those points to which the wind
blows after passing over them.
Inattention to that consideration has led to the loss of much human
life, and to the fruitless expenditure of much money in the erection of
houses, barracks, and the like, which, after completion, have been found
to be totally uninhabitable, from the pestilential vapours carried to
them by the winds. In illustration of the influence of winds, we submit
the following interesting extract from Dr Good’s Study of Medicine. He
has been speaking of effluvia from animal matter. “But the foul and
stinking Harmattan,” (a pestilential wind) “when it rushes from the
south-east upon the Guinea coast, loaded with vegetable exhalations
alone, with which it impregnates itself while sweeping over the immense
uninhabitable swamps and oozy mangrove thickets of the sultry regions of
Benin, triumphs in a still more rapid and wasteful destruction; so much
that Dr Lind informs us, that the mortality produced by this
pestilential vapour in the year 1754 or 1755 was so general, that in
several negro towns, the living were not sufficient to bury the dead;
and that the gates of Cape Coast Castle were shut up for want of
sentinels to perform duty. Blacks and whites falling promiscuously
before this fatal scourge.”
So loaded is the air on some occasions with these pestilential vapours,
that they attach themselves to whatever objects they meet, houses, the
sides of hills, and woods, through which they pass along with the wind,
and so completely has a wood stripped the currents of their baneful
accompaniments, that they have been respired after with no injury
whatever.
